Studying a patient with neurological deficits, scientists discovered autoantibodies against the #transcobalamin receptor CD320 that lead to #VitaminB12 deficiency in the central nervous system, but not in the blood. John Pluvinage UC San Francisco scim.ag/7wN

Our meta-analysis comparing intracranial hemorrhage risks w/ ASA vs apix, now online @ Stroke. Contrary to common perceptions, we found no evidence in the ischemic stroke prevention setting that apix confers higher intracranial bleeding risk vs ASA.
